Dirt, dust, or old paint can prevent adhesives or fasteners from properly bonding. Use a <strong data-start=\"390\" data-end=\"425\">wire brush or industrial vacuum<\/strong> to remove loose debris. For concrete or masonry columns, minor surface irregularities can be leveled with a thin layer of <strong data-start=\"548\" data-end=\"571\">cementitious filler<\/strong>, ensuring an even base.<\/p>\n<p data-start=\"599\" data-end=\"989\">For example, in a high-rise office in Chicago, uneven concrete columns caused gaps during initial panel installation. After smoothing the surface with a grinder and filler, installers achieved alignment within <strong data-start=\"809\" data-end=\"827\">2 mm tolerance<\/strong>, preventing costly rework. For metal columns, a <strong data-start=\"876\" data-end=\"896\">degreasing agent<\/strong> helps remove oil residues, improving adhesion for both adhesives and mechanical fasteners.<\/p>\n<h4 data-start=\"991\" data-end=\"1048\">2.2 Applying Primer or Protective Coating if Needed<\/h4>\n<p data-start=\"1049\" data-end=\"1303\">Applying a primer or protective coating enhances the longevity of your cladding system. For <strong data-start=\"1141\" data-end=\"1179\">stainless steel or aluminum panels<\/strong>, a corrosion-resistant primer on the column surface prevents rust formation, especially in humid or coastal environments.<\/p>\n<p data-start=\"1305\" data-end=\"1338\"><strong data-start=\"1305\" data-end=\"1335\">Key considerations include<\/strong>\uff1a<\/p>\n<ol data-start=\"1339\" data-end=\"1657\">\n<li data-start=\"1339\" data-end=\"1434\">\n<p data-start=\"1342\" data-end=\"1434\"><strong data-start=\"1342\" data-end=\"1357\">Primer type<\/strong>\uff1aUse epoxy-based primers for concrete and anti-corrosion primers for metal.<\/p>\n<\/li>\n<li data-start=\"1435\" data-end=\"1564\">\n<p data-start=\"1438\" data-end=\"1564\"><strong data-start=\"1438\" data-end=\"1450\">Coverage<\/strong>\uff1aEnsure full coverage of the column, including corners and edges, typically requiring <strong data-start=\"1536\" data-end=\"1561\">1.2\u20131.5 liters per m\u00b2<\/strong>.<\/p>\n<\/li>\n<li data-start=\"1565\" data-end=\"1657\">\n<p data-start=\"1568\" data-end=\"1657\"><strong data-start=\"1568\" data-end=\"1583\">Drying time<\/strong>\uff1aMost primers require <strong data-start=\"1605\" data-end=\"1618\">2\u20134 hours<\/strong> drying at 20\u00b0C for optimal adhesion.<\/p>\n<\/li>\n<\/ol>\n<p data-start=\"1659\" data-end=\"1982\">In practice, a luxury hotel in Miami applied primer to all lobby columns before installing <strong data-start=\"1750\" data-end=\"1855\">stainless steel column cladding<\/strong>. This step prevented any discoloration or rust streaks despite the high humidity and frequent cleaning with mild detergents.<\/p>\n<h4 data-start=\"1984\" data-end=\"2023\">2.3 Ensuring Structural Stability<\/h4>\n<p data-start=\"2024\" data-end=\"2417\">A secure base is essential for any cladding system. Inspect columns for cracks, spalling, or structural weaknesses. Minor cracks can be repaired with high-strength mortar, while more significant damage may require reinforcement. Ensure that columns can <strong data-start=\"2277\" data-end=\"2321\">bear the added weight of cladding panels<\/strong>, which for stainless steel or aluminum can range from <strong data-start=\"2376\" data-end=\"2391\">15\u201330 kg\/m\u00b2<\/strong> depending on thickness.<\/p>\n<div class=\"_tableContainer_1rjym_1\">\n<div class=\"group _tableWrapper_1rjym_13 flex w-fit flex-col-reverse\" tabindex=\"-1\">\n<table class=\"w-fit min-w-(--thread-content-width)\" style=\"width: 96.9308%;\" data-start=\"2419\" data-end=\"3045\">\n<thead data-start=\"2419\" data-end=\"2547\">\n<tr data-start=\"2419\" data-end=\"2547\">\n<th style=\"width: 16.8297%;\" data-start=\"2419\" data-end=\"2441\" data-col-size=\"sm\">Column Type<\/th>\n<th style=\"width: 27.9843%;\" data-start=\"2441\" data-end=\"2474\" data-col-size=\"sm\">Maximum Load per Panel (kg\/m\u00b2)<\/th>\n<th style=\"width: 31.8982%;\" data-start=\"2474\" data-end=\"2510\" data-col-size=\"sm\">Recommended Support Reinforcement<\/th>\n<th style=\"width: 53.5225%;\" data-start=\"2510\" data-end=\"2547\" data-col-size=\"sm\">Typical Use Case<\/th>\n<\/tr>\n<\/thead>\n<tbody data-start=\"2672\" data-end=\"3045\">\n<tr data-start=\"2672\" data-end=\"2795\">\n<td style=\"width: 16.8297%;\" data-start=\"2672\" data-end=\"2693\" data-col-size=\"sm\">Concrete<\/td>\n<td style=\"width: 27.9843%;\" data-start=\"2693\" data-end=\"2725\" data-col-size=\"sm\">30<\/td>\n<td style=\"width: 31.8982%;\" data-start=\"2725\" data-end=\"2759\" data-col-size=\"sm\">Metal brackets or anchor bolts<\/td>\n<td style=\"width: 53.5225%;\" data-start=\"2759\" data-end=\"2795\" data-col-size=\"sm\">High-rise commercial buildings<\/td>\n<\/tr>\n<tr data-start=\"2796\" data-end=\"2920\">\n<td style=\"width: 16.8297%;\" data-start=\"2796\" data-end=\"2817\" data-col-size=\"sm\">Steel<\/td>\n<td style=\"width: 27.9843%;\" data-start=\"2817\" data-end=\"2849\" data-col-size=\"sm\">25<\/td>\n<td style=\"width: 31.8982%;\" data-start=\"2849\" data-end=\"2883\" data-col-size=\"sm\">Welding or bolted supports<\/td>\n<td style=\"width: 53.5225%;\" data-start=\"2883\" data-end=\"2920\" data-col-size=\"sm\">Interior or exterior columns<\/td>\n<\/tr>\n<tr data-start=\"2921\" data-end=\"3045\">\n<td style=\"width: 16.8297%;\" data-start=\"2921\" data-end=\"2945\" data-col-size=\"sm\">Composite\/Lightweight<\/td>\n<td style=\"width: 27.9843%;\" data-start=\"2945\" data-end=\"2975\" data-col-size=\"sm\">15<\/td>\n<td style=\"width: 31.8982%;\" data-start=\"2975\" data-end=\"3008\" data-col-size=\"sm\">Adhesive plus minimal brackets<\/td>\n<td style=\"width: 53.5225%;\" data-start=\"3008\" data-end=\"3045\" data-col-size=\"sm\">Decorative interior columns<\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<\/div>\n<\/div>\n<p data-start=\"3047\" data-end=\"3345\">For a shopping mall in Los Angeles, engineers verified all concrete columns could support <strong data-start=\"3137\" data-end=\"3155\">up to 28 kg\/m\u00b2<\/strong> of panel weight. Use <strong data-start=\"508\" data-end=\"536\">stainless steel brackets<\/strong> for heavy panels, especially in high-traffic areas. The number of brackets depends on column height and panel weight: typically, <strong data-start=\"666\" data-end=\"707\">one bracket every 50\u201360 cm vertically<\/strong> provides optimal stability.<\/p>\n<p data-start=\"739\" data-end=\"757\">Steps to follow\uff1a<\/p>\n<ol data-start=\"758\" data-end=\"1135\">\n<li data-start=\"758\" data-end=\"847\">\n<p data-start=\"761\" data-end=\"847\"><strong data-start=\"761\" data-end=\"787\">Mark bracket positions<\/strong> on the column using a laser level to ensure even spacing.<\/p>\n<\/li>\n<li data-start=\"848\" data-end=\"994\">\n<p data-start=\"851\" data-end=\"994\"><strong data-start=\"851\" data-end=\"872\">Drill pilot holes<\/strong> for screws or anchors, matching the diameter to the bracket specifications (commonly <strong data-start=\"958\" data-end=\"969\">8\u201312 mm<\/strong> for concrete columns).<\/p>\n<\/li>\n<li data-start=\"995\" data-end=\"1135\">\n<p data-start=\"998\" data-end=\"1135\"><strong data-start=\"998\" data-end=\"1021\">Secure the brackets<\/strong> with corrosion-resistant screws or bolts. For exterior projects, use stainless steel fasteners to prevent rust.<\/p>\n<\/li>\n<\/ol>\n<p data-start=\"1137\" data-end=\"1335\">In a New York office tower, brackets were spaced <strong data-start=\"1186\" data-end=\"1201\">55 cm apart<\/strong> to hold stainless steel panels weighing <strong data-start=\"1242\" data-end=\"1254\">22 kg\/m\u00b2<\/strong>. This setup maintained perfect vertical alignment even under heavy wind loads.<\/p>\n<h4 data-start=\"1337\" data-end=\"1382\">3.2 Leveling and Aligning the Framework<\/h4>\n<p data-start=\"1383\" data-end=\"1591\">Leveling the framework is crucial to avoid misaligned panels that look sloppy or create gaps. Use temporary supports or clamps to hold panels in place.<\/p>\n<p data-start=\"555\" data-end=\"567\">Key steps\uff1a<\/p>\n<ol data-start=\"568\" data-end=\"1062\">\n<li data-start=\"568\" data-end=\"737\">\n<p data-start=\"571\" data-end=\"737\"><strong data-start=\"571\" data-end=\"595\">Mark panel positions<\/strong> on the framework using a pencil or chalk line. Precision matters\u2014a <strong data-start=\"663\" data-end=\"684\">2 mm misalignment<\/strong> on a 3-meter-tall column becomes visually obvious.<\/p>\n<\/li>\n<li data-start=\"738\" data-end=\"937\">\n<p data-start=\"741\" data-end=\"937\"><strong data-start=\"741\" data-end=\"785\">Place the panel starting from the bottom<\/strong>, as gravity helps maintain alignment. Taller columns often benefit from <strong data-start=\"858\" data-end=\"886\">2\u20133 installers per panel<\/strong> to ensure safe handling and precise positioning.<\/p>\n<\/li>\n<li data-start=\"938\" data-end=\"1062\">\n<p data-start=\"941\" data-end=\"1062\"><strong data-start=\"941\" data-end=\"973\">Check spacing between panels<\/strong>. For metal panels, maintain <strong data-start=\"1002\" data-end=\"1012\">2\u20134 mm<\/strong> expansion gaps to accommodate thermal movement.<\/p>\n<\/li>\n<\/ol>\n<p data-start=\"1064\" data-end=\"1416\">A luxury hotel in Miami used <strong data-start=\"1093\" data-end=\"1198\"><a class=\"decorated-link\" href=\"https:\/\/www.pvdstainlesssteel.com\/km\/stainless-steel-column-cladding\/\" target=\"_new\" rel=\"noopener\" data-start=\"1095\" data-end=\"1196\">stainless steel column cladding<\/a><\/strong> in the lobby. Stainless steel and aluminum panels typically use screws or clips, while lighter composite panels can also use high-strength adhesives.<\/p>\n<p data-start=\"1678\" data-end=\"1696\">Steps to follow\uff1a<\/p>\n<ol data-start=\"1697\" data-end=\"2245\">\n<li data-start=\"1697\" data-end=\"1840\">\n<p data-start=\"1700\" data-end=\"1840\"><strong data-start=\"1700\" data-end=\"1749\">Select fasteners compatible with the material<\/strong>. For stainless steel panels, use <strong data-start=\"1783\" data-end=\"1818\">stainless steel screws or clips<\/strong> to avoid corrosion.<\/p>\n<\/li>\n<li data-start=\"1841\" data-end=\"1974\">\n<p data-start=\"1844\" data-end=\"1974\"><strong data-start=\"1844\" data-end=\"1875\">Pre-drill holes if required<\/strong>. For thick metal panels, drilling pilot holes of <strong data-start=\"1925\" data-end=\"1935\">3\u20135 mm<\/strong> diameter prevents panel deformation.<\/p>\n<\/li>\n<li data-start=\"1975\" data-end=\"2102\">\n<p data-start=\"1978\" data-end=\"2102\"><strong data-start=\"1978\" data-end=\"2017\">Attach the panel from the bottom up<\/strong>, gradually fastening screws or clips. Alternate sides to avoid twisting or bowing.<\/p>\n<\/li>\n<li data-start=\"2103\" data-end=\"2245\">\n<p data-start=\"2106\" data-end=\"2245\"><strong data-start=\"2106\" data-end=\"2162\">Check vertical and horizontal alignment continuously<\/strong> with a laser level. Even small deviations can accumulate across multiple panels.<\/p>\n<\/li>\n<\/ol>\n<p data-start=\"2247\" data-end=\"2461\">In a New York commercial lobby, installers fastened <strong data-start=\"2299\" data-end=\"2334\">22 kg\/m\u00b2 stainless steel panels<\/strong> using corrosion-resistant screws every <strong data-start=\"2374\" data-end=\"2404\">40 cm along vertical seams<\/strong>, securing panels tightly without damaging the surface.<\/p>\n<h4 data-start=\"2463\" data-end=\"2518\">4.3 Adjusting Seams and Edges for a Smooth Finish<\/h4>\n<p data-start=\"2519\" data-end=\"2599\">Proper seam and edge alignment gives the column a professional, seamless look.<\/p>\n<p data-start=\"2601\" data-end=\"2623\">Tips and techniques\uff1a<\/p>\n<ol data-start=\"2624\" data-end=\"3163\">\n<li data-start=\"2624\" data-end=\"2756\">\n<p data-start=\"2627\" data-end=\"2756\"><strong data-start=\"2627\" data-end=\"2650\">Use a rubber mallet<\/strong> to gently tap panels into position if needed. Avoid metal hammers that can scratch or dent the surface.<\/p>\n<\/li>\n<li data-start=\"2757\" data-end=\"2879\">\n<p data-start=\"2760\" data-end=\"2879\"><strong data-start=\"2760\" data-end=\"2786\">Check for uniform gaps<\/strong> at corners and edges. A consistent gap of <strong data-start=\"2829\" data-end=\"2839\">2\u20133 mm<\/strong> allows for expansion and contraction.<\/p>\n<\/li>\n<li data-start=\"2880\" data-end=\"3035\">\n<p data-start=\"2883\" data-end=\"3035\"><strong data-start=\"2883\" data-end=\"2927\">Apply finishing trims or corner profiles<\/strong> to hide edges or end panels. Stainless steel trims often match the panel finish and add aesthetic appeal.<\/p>\n<\/li>\n<li data-start=\"3036\" data-end=\"3163\">\n<p data-start=\"3039\" data-end=\"3163\"><strong data-start=\"3039\" data-end=\"3067\">Inspect the installation<\/strong> under different lighting angles. Reflections on metal panels reveal even minor misalignments.<\/p>\n<\/li>\n<\/ol>\n<p data-start=\"3165\" data-end=\"3531\">A boutique hotel in Los Angeles applied <strong data-start=\"3205\" data-end=\"3291\">column cladding panels<\/strong> across all lobby columns.
